Dances with Dirt, Hell, MI.
Team finished 3rd out of 400 team. Everyone did well. I ran three legs.
4th - Poto. The longest, 9.8 km. All nice trail, mostly winding single track, and a lot of small hills the first half which made the running pretty intense, no time to relax and getting the long stride out. Last few km was pretty flat with some sandy sections. Time 42 min. A good start.

10th. Where's the F'n bridge? 7.6 km. The first 5 km was the same kind of nice trails as in the morning and I felt good, picking up the pace slightly compared with the first leg, That pace however was changed dramatically. The last 2,5 km was through a swamp, literally, and it also included a lake crossing. In some of the worst sections, they had put ropes that you could hold on to. Or you had to unless you wanted to stay in the swamp. Despite ropes, I went down to my neck in one hole, but I still enjoyed it and didn't loose as much time on these leg to the top team as on the first leg. Time 36 min.

14th. Don't Get Better. 4.6 km. The first 500 m was straight through the bush and thorns, but the rest was nice trails. Last run for the day so I gave it all and it felt good although the hills were getting painful, BUT then it happened. I missed a turn and continue to run for 400-500 m until I got to a trail intersection with no markers indicating which trail to take. Looked in each direction before I realized I was in the wrong place and went back and I was able to find the turn. That sucked. 26 km (ended up to be 6 km according to Garmin).
